丁香五月色情久久久久,亚洲精品久久久久久,欧美一区二区三区成人片在线,caoporen免费精品视频

歡迎光臨東莞市正航儀器設備有限公司官網

正航儀器 高新技術企業

可靠環境試驗設備制造商

12年自主研發生產 ,上萬家企業成功見證

全國免費咨詢熱線

400-822-8565

當前位置: 首頁 > 新聞資訊 > 公司新聞

自適應遺傳算法未成熟原因

文章出處:正航儀器 人氣: 發表時間:2014-01-17
 
 
 

 
在環境試驗設備實際操作實踐中,很多參數優化問題是多參數和非線性的,且往往還伴隨著不可微和參數耦合問題。這時用傳統的優化方法解決這種問題效率很低,有時甚至得不出結果。遺傳算法的強魯棒性和有效性為解決這類問題提供一種有效的途徑。
遺傳算法的特點在于,在模擬自然界生物進化過程中,應用了自然界的進化規律,染色體的交叉,變異的現象結合自然選擇過程使得物種不斷向前進化。遺傳算法也因此顯示出了頑強的生命力并且越來越受到重視。但遺傳算法作為一種隨機搜索算法也存在著一些缺點,其中最主要的問題是未成熟收斂(Prematureconvergence PC)問題和進化后期搜索效率下降問題。
自適應遺傳算法未成熟原因
在下文中將根據如何解這兩個主要問題改進標準遺傳算法,從而形成自適應遺傳算法。但在此之前首先要明白什么是未成熟收斂,及其形成的原因。未成熟收斂現象是遺傳算法中特有的現象,且十分常見。它指的是,當還未達到全局最優解或滿意解時,群體中不能再產生性能超過父代的后代。其主要特征是種群中個體結構的多樣性急劇下降。
產生未成熟收斂的主要原因有:
一 理論上考慮的選擇、交叉、變異操作是的,它們之間相互協調,能搜索到整個解空間,在時間趨于無窮時以概率一收斂到最優解。但實際過程中,有些問題的求解要求滿足一定的快速性,因此不可能等到時間趨于無窮便要求系統給出當前最優解,所以很難達到理論上的要求。
二 遺傳算法處理的種群的規模是有限的,因而存在隨機誤差。它主要包括取樣誤差和選擇誤差。由于染色體在遺傳操作中只能產生整數個后代,在有限規模的種群中,模板的樣本不可能以任意精度反映所要求的比例,這是產生取樣誤差的根本原因。加上隨機選擇的誤差就可以導致模板樣品數量和理論預測值有很大差別。隨著這種偏差的積累,一些有用的模板將會從種群中消失,有害的模板可能會保留下來,從而引起遺傳漂移,最終導致算法效率降低。
三 所求解的問題是遺傳算法的欺騙性問題。當解決的問題對于標準遺傳算法來說比較困難時,遺傳算法便會偏離尋優方向,這種問題被稱為遺傳算法欺騙問題。
上述三個方面都有可能產生未成熟收斂現象,使得種群中個體結構多樣性過早的丟失,從而使算法陷入局部極值點。http://www.szhaotaitai.com 
下一篇: 暫無 上一篇: 自適應遺傳算法的提出
此文關鍵詞: